ABSTRACT

Companies in both emerging economies and developed countries are facing serious climate change, digital transformation and cybersecurity risks. These could seriously affect their future business growths and sustainable business profitability. In particular, renewable companies have to develop appropriate digital transformation strategies to improve their performance and efficiency whilst maintaining high cybersecurity. Cyber security improvements are key to protect renewable companies against growing cyber attacks and risks of fraud. There should be strong management support for the elimination of legacy systems and organisational reforms to accelerate digital reforms and improve cyber security. Different interlinkages between climate change, renewables, digital transformation and cyber security will be discussed in this chapter with business examples.
